What are Network Engineer Contracts?

Network Engineer Contracts are temporary work arrangements in which a network engineer is hired for a specific period or project, rather than as a permanent employee. Contract network engineers are responsible for designing, implementing, and maintaining an organization's computer networks, often focusing on tasks like troubleshooting, upgrades, or migrations. These roles can offer flexibility, higher hourly rates, and opportunities to work on diverse projects, but may not include benefits like health insurance or paid time off. Contract positions are common in IT, especially for specialized skills or short-term needs.

What are some common challenges faced by contract network engineers, and how can they be effectively managed?

Contract network engineers often encounter challenges such as quickly adapting to new organizational environments, understanding unique network infrastructures, and integrating with existing IT teams. To manage these challenges effectively, it's crucial to be proactive in communicating with key stakeholders, thoroughly document any changes made, and stay current with industry-standard protocols and tools. Building rapport with permanent staff and leveraging onboarding resources can also help streamline the transition and ensure successful project delivery.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Network Engineer Contract,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Network Engineer Contract, you need a solid understanding of networking protocols, infrastructure design, and troubleshooting, typically back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Cisco IOS, network monitoring software, and certifications such as CCNA or CCNP are commonly expected.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and adaptability are crucial soft skills for managing dynamic IT environments and collaborating with diverse teams. These skills ensure reliable network performance, minimize downtime, and support organizational connectivity needs in contract-based settings.
